Anarchy Online News - Virtual Items Sales

Posted by Keith Cross on Oct 12, 2007  | 11 comments in our forums

Funcom has announced that they have launched virtual items sales in Anarchy Online on all servers in a new mini-expansion.  Among the new items that will be made available are hover boards and bikes, pets, social clothing, and more.

Durham, USA – October 12, 2007 – Funcom has now launched the virtual item sales in Anarchy Online. In yet another progressive move from Funcom, the players on Rubi-Ka are now able to purchase sets of points which can be used to acquire virtual items inside the game. The first virtual items introduced with the program come packed inside a new mini-expansion. Amongst other things the new pack includes hover-bikes, hover-boards, social clothing, pets and a luxury apartment. Our focus is to ensure that the virtual items do not affect gameplay balance.

The points are available in three different packages which can be purchased for 10, 20 or 40 USD / EUR, where 100 points is the equivalent of 1 USD / EUR. A new hover-board starts as low as 300 points, but the players can also purchase an entire range. As an introductory offer the players can purchase the entire new collection of boards and bikes for 2000 points.

“This kind of system puts the choice in the hands of the players by allowing them to take as little or as much of the new content as they like,” said Craig Morrison, Game Director on Anarchy Online. “It really adds an extra dimension to what we can provide in terms of fun social items, designed to look cool while being something players don't feel forced into. That extra element of choice has allowed us to add a much broader range of items than we might if we were simply targeting it into a self contained expansion.”
